About this property

Koka`s Panda House, Cozy cabin, wood fireplace, great view of Elk Ridge Valley

Welcome to Koka's Panda Cabin!
Your serene escape in the Elk Ridge neighborhood of Duck Creek Village, Utah.

Nestled among majestic red mountains and towering pines, Koka's Panda Cabin is the perfect retreat for family vacations or group getaways. This charming cabin offers the ideal balance of comfort and adventure, with modern amenities and easy year-round access thanks to maintained roads, including winter snow removal.

About the Cabin
Bedrooms: 3 private bedrooms, each featuring a cozy queen bed, plus an open loft with a queen bed that serves as a versatile 4th sleeping area.
Bathrooms: 2.5 bathrooms, ensuring plenty of space for everyone.
Accommodations: Sleeps up to 8 guests comfortably.
Spacious Living: Relax in the inviting living room or prepare meals in the fully equipped kitchen, perfect for gathering after a day of exploring.
Why You'll Love Staying Here
Prime Location: Conveniently located at the junction of US 89 and SR 14, offering quick access to nearby attractions and outdoor adventures.
Year-Round Fun: Whether it's summer hikes or winter snow play, Elk Ridge provides the perfect backdrop for every season.
Wildlife Encounters: Spot deer, turkeys, and other wildlife as you unwind on the cabin’s peaceful grounds.
Explore Southern Utah
From Koka's Panda Cabin, you'll have easy access to some of Utah’s most iconic destinations:

Day Trips: Visit Zion National Park, Bryce Canyon National Park, or Cedar Breaks National Monument, all just a short drive away.
Outdoor Activities:
Fish at Navajo Lake or Panguitch Lake.
Explore miles of ATV and hiking trails through the scenic Dixie National Forest.
Take a leisurely stroll around Duck Creek Pond.
Local Convenience: Gas, groceries, and supplies are just a short walk from the cabin, making it easy to stock up for your stay.
After a day of adventure, return to the comfort of Koka's Panda Cabin to relax under starry skies or gather with loved ones for a cozy evening in. Whether you’re here for thrilling outdoor activities or quiet moments in nature, this cabin offers the perfect home base for your Utah getaway.

Clean and comfortable interior, but not comfortable outside

If you want a location in between Bryce and Zion for a couple days, I think this works. About 40 minutes to Bryce and an hour to Zion (the tunnel). It served the purpose for us, but wasn't fantastic. No grocery options nearby - the local gas station IS NOT reliable for groceries. Beds were comfortable. The interior was clean. Wifi worked once we received the password. The exterior was really lacking - broken chairs, discarded objects and tools right on the entrance stoop. Why isn't that stuff removed so a renter wouldn't see it? The listing doesn't show exterior pictures of the property. That's telling. It's kinda sad that a small amount of work would make the outside shine and the location with animal tracks and we heard elk bugles is really nice - but no chairs on the deck to sit outside and enjoy it. I don't understand having a home with a deck this big and not tempting your renters to enjoy the outdoors! The exterior maintenance was strikingly off on this property - take care of the logs that make up the structure! The neighborhood was upscale but this property felt declining. I don't intend an entirely negative review. Main advice: - Clean up outside. - Add deck furniture. - Leave your wifi password on a note in the property so we're not working to get it (cellphone access is spotty) I wouldn't recommend if you want to relax outside at a property in this area. I would recommend if you don't care about being outside. Regardless, bring all your groceries!
